Ultrathin CIGS cell based on tungsten disulfide promises 25.7% efficiency

Researchers from Visvesvaraya National Institute of Technology in India proposed a new CIGS solar cell structure using WS2 as the BSF layer, achieving 25.70% efficiency at specific thicknesses. WS2 functions as an electron transport or buffer layer and is utilized in nanoelectronics and energy storage devices. The research aims to reduce rare earth material consumption in CIGS cells.
